Default CN Block Party #34 On Sale June 27

Hi all:

Next Wedesday, the new issue of Cartoon Network Block Party goes on sale, featuring a tale of Foster-fueld fun! Here's the solicitation from DC Comics:

"It's a race against time to find the Three Legged Race Monster before it finds the Bean Scouts! Plus, watch what happens when Bloo enters a pie-eating contest!"

I'll bet hilarity ensues.
